How much does it cost to rent a home in Whitney?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Whitney 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,467 | $925 | $2,350 |
Whitney 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,966 | $1,350 | $4,500 |
Whitney 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,425 | $650 | $4,499 |
Whitney 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,562 | $2,000 | $3,500 |
Whitney 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,055 | $1,790 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Whitney
What type of rentals are currently available in Whitney?
There are currently 67 Apartments for Rent in Whitney, NV with pricing that ranges from $695 to $4,031. There are also 254 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Whitney ranging from $650 to $11,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Whitney?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Whitney ranges from $650 to $11,500 with an average monthly rent of $2,219.
